ホームページ >ウェブフロントエンド >jsチュートリアル >js関数プロジェクトの一般的なメソッドのまとめ

js関数プロジェクトの一般的なメソッドのまとめ

php中世界最好的语言
php中世界最好的语言オリジナル
2018-06-04 17:42:061885ブラウズ

今回は、js 関数プロジェクトでよくあるメソッドと、js 関数プロジェクトでよくある注意点についてまとめました。実際の事例を見てみましょう。
1. オブジェクト宣言

var obj = new Object;
obj.name = '';
obj['sex'] = '';
2. JSON形式を使用

var obj = {'key':'val'};

オブジェクトアクセス

function obj(){
this.name = '';
}
var p = new obj();
2.

オブジェクトトラバーサルを使用

.
[]
this
タンインオブジェクト

文字列オブジェクト宣言

for()  遍历数组
for..in 遍历对象
with(obj){
}
メソッド

var str = new String();
var str = '';

配列オブジェクト
宣言
trim()  清除两侧的空白
charAt()  获取字符串指定位置上的字符
indexOf()  获取指定字符或者字符串首次出现的位置
lastIndexOf()  获取指定字符或者字符串最后一次出现的位置
concat()  连接两个或者多个字符串
slice()  截取字符串 从开始到结束   要前不要后
split()  按照指定的字符或者字符串来拆分字符串数组
substr()  截取字符串
toLowerCase()  将字符串转化成小写
toUpperCase()  将字符串转化成大写
replace()  替换一个与正则表达式匹配的子字符串

関数

var arr = [];
var arr = new Array()


配列に関する注意事項

1. 配列は[]を使用して直接代入することはできません

2 添字には連続性があります

3。いいえ。連想配列4. 二次元配列
使用

concat()  连接一个或多个数组
join()  将数组元素连接起来转化成一个字符串
reverse()  翻转数组的元素
slice()  返回数组的一部分
sort()  对数组元素进行排序
splice()  插入、删除或替换数组的元素
push()  从数组的尾部压入元素
pop()  从数组的尾部删除元素
unshift()  从数组的头部插入一个元素
shift()  从数组的头部删除一个元素

時間オブジェクト
インスタンス化
var a = [];
a[0] = [];
a[1] = []
[
[],
[],
[],
]
メソッド


var date = new Date;

数学オブジェクト
getFullYear() 获取年份
getMonth()  获取月份
获取当前的月份 +1
getDate()  获取天
getHours()  获取小时  
getMinutes()  获取分钟
getSeconds()  获取秒  
getDay()  获取星期
0-6   对应着星期日至星期六

この記事の事例を読んでメソッドをマスターしたと思います。 php 中国語 Web サイトの他の関連記事にも注目してください。

推奨書籍:

JSの継承メソッドのまとめ(事例付き)

JSフレームワークライブラリのユースケースの詳細な説明

以上がjs関数プロジェクトの一般的なメソッドのまとめの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。